/*
 * Given a file descriptor, create a capability with specific rights and
 * make sure only those rights work. 
*/
static int
try_file_ops(int fd, cap_rights_t rights)
{
	struct stat sb;
	struct statfs sf;
	int fd_cap, fd_capcap;
	ssize_t ssize, ssize2;
	off_t off;
	void *p;
	char ch;
	int ret, is_nfs;
	struct pollfd pollfd;
	int success = PASSED;

	REQUIRE(fstatfs(fd, &sf));
	is_nfs = (strncmp("nfs", sf.f_fstypename, sizeof(sf.f_fstypename))
	    == 0);

	REQUIRE(fd_cap = cap_new(fd, rights));
	REQUIRE(fd_capcap = cap_new(fd_cap, rights));
	CHECK(fd_capcap != fd_cap);

	pollfd.fd = fd_cap;
	pollfd.events = POLLIN | POLLERR | POLLHUP;
	pollfd.revents = 0;

	ssize = read(fd_cap, &ch, sizeof(ch));
	CHECK_RESULT(read, CAP_READ | CAP_SEEK, ssize >= 0);

	ssize = pread(fd_cap, &ch, sizeof(ch), 0);
	ssize2 = pread(fd_cap, &ch, sizeof(ch), 0);
	CHECK_RESULT(pread, CAP_READ, ssize >= 0);
	CHECK(ssize == ssize2);

	ssize = write(fd_cap, &ch, sizeof(ch));
	CHECK_RESULT(write, CAP_WRITE | CAP_SEEK, ssize >= 0);

	ssize = pwrite(fd_cap, &ch, sizeof(ch), 0);
	CHECK_RESULT(pwrite, CAP_WRITE, ssize >= 0);

	off = lseek(fd_cap, 0, SEEK_SET);
	CHECK_RESULT(lseek, CAP_SEEK, off >= 0);

	/*
	 * Note: this is not expected to work over NFS.
	 */
	ret = fchflags(fd_cap, UF_NODUMP);
	CHECK_RESULT(fchflags, CAP_FCHFLAGS,
	    (ret == 0) || (is_nfs && (errno == EOPNOTSUPP)));

	ret = fstat(fd_cap, &sb);
	CHECK_RESULT(fstat, CAP_FSTAT, ret == 0);

	p = mmap(NULL, getpagesize(), PROT_READ, MAP_SHARED, fd_cap, 0);
	CHECK_MMAP_RESULT(CAP_MMAP | CAP_READ);

	p = mmap(NULL, getpagesize(), PROT_WRITE, MAP_SHARED, fd_cap, 0);
	CHECK_MMAP_RESULT(CAP_MMAP | CAP_WRITE);

	p = mmap(NULL, getpagesize(), PROT_EXEC, MAP_SHARED, fd_cap, 0);
	CHECK_MMAP_RESULT(CAP_MMAP | CAP_MAPEXEC);

	p = mmap(NULL, getpagesize(), PROT_READ | PROT_WRITE, MAP_SHARED,
	    fd_cap, 0);
	CHECK_MMAP_RESULT(CAP_MMAP | CAP_READ | CAP_WRITE);

	p = mmap(NULL, getpagesize(), PROT_READ | PROT_EXEC, MAP_SHARED,
	    fd_cap, 0);
	CHECK_MMAP_RESULT(CAP_MMAP | CAP_READ | CAP_MAPEXEC);

	p = mmap(NULL, getpagesize(), PROT_EXEC | PROT_WRITE, MAP_SHARED,
	    fd_cap, 0);
	CHECK_MMAP_RESULT(CAP_MMAP | CAP_MAPEXEC | CAP_WRITE);

	p = mmap(NULL, getpagesize(), PROT_READ | PROT_WRITE | PROT_EXEC,
	    MAP_SHARED, fd_cap, 0);
	CHECK_MMAP_RESULT(CAP_MMAP | CAP_READ | CAP_WRITE | CAP_MAPEXEC);

	ret = fsync(fd_cap);
	CHECK_RESULT(fsync, CAP_FSYNC, ret == 0);

	ret = fchown(fd_cap, -1, -1);
	CHECK_RESULT(fchown, CAP_FCHOWN, ret == 0);

	ret = fchmod(fd_cap, 0644);
	CHECK_RESULT(fchmod, CAP_FCHMOD, ret == 0);

	/* XXX flock */

	ret = ftruncate(fd_cap, 0);
	CHECK_RESULT(ftruncate, CAP_FTRUNCATE, ret == 0);

	ret = fstatfs(fd_cap, &sf);
	CHECK_RESULT(fstatfs, CAP_FSTATFS, ret == 0);

	ret = fpathconf(fd_cap, _PC_NAME_MAX);
	CHECK_RESULT(fpathconf, CAP_FPATHCONF, ret >= 0);

	ret = futimes(fd_cap, NULL);
	CHECK_RESULT(futimes, CAP_FUTIMES, ret == 0);

	ret = poll(&pollfd, 1, 0);
	if (rights & CAP_POLL_EVENT)
		CHECK((pollfd.revents & POLLNVAL) == 0);
	else
		CHECK((pollfd.revents & POLLNVAL) != 0);

	/* XXX: select, kqueue */

	close (fd_cap);
	return (success);
}

/* Updates inventory based on the current state of event log path */
static int
inv_update(sam_fsa_inv_t **invp)
{
	sam_fsa_inv_t *inv;
	int dir_fd = -1;
	DIR *dirp = NULL;
	struct dirent *ent; /* Directory entry */
	int i;
	int rst = 0;
	struct stat sb; /* Status buffer (stat(2)) */
	boolean_t is_changed = FALSE;

	inv = *invp;

	if ((dir_fd = open(inv->path_fsa, O_RDONLY, 0)) < 0) {
		Trace(TR_ERR, "Error opening %s", inv->path_fsa);
		rst = -1;
		goto out;
	}

	if ((dirp = fdopendir(dir_fd)) == NULL) {
		Trace(TR_ERR, "Error opening %s from fd.",
		    inv->path_fsa);
		rst = -1;
		goto out;
	}

	SamMalloc(ent, sizeof (dirent_t) +
	    fpathconf(dir_fd, _PC_NAME_MAX));

	/* Mark inventory (looking for deleted files) */
	for (i = 0; i < inv->n_logs; i++) {
		inv->logs[i].status |= fstat_MARK;
	}

	/* Loop through files in event log directory. */
	while (readdir_r(dirp, ent) != NULL) {
		if (!is_event_logfile(inv, ent->d_name)) {
			continue;
		}

		if (fstatat(dir_fd, ent->d_name, &sb,
		    AT_SYMLINK_NOFOLLOW) == -1) {
			Trace(TR_ERR, "lstat(%s/%s) error",
			    inv->path_fsa, ent->d_name);
			errno = 0;
			continue;
		}

		if (sb.st_size == 0) {
			continue; /* ignore if empty */
		}

		/* Search inventory for file. */
		for (i = 0; i < inv->n_logs; i++) {
			/* If found unmark and continue */
			if (strcmp(ent->d_name,
			    inv->logs[i].name) == 0) {
				inv->logs[i].status &= ~fstat_MARK;
				break;
			}
		}

		/* If file not found add to inventory */
		if (i >= inv->n_logs) {
			/* Newly found log file, add to inventory */
			inv_add_file(invp, ent->d_name, dir_fd);
			/* invp might have been realloc'd */
			inv = *invp;
			is_changed = TRUE;
		}
	}

	/* Change status of deleted files */
	for (i = 0; i < inv->n_logs; i++) {
		if (inv->logs[i].status & fstat_MARK) {
			inv->logs[i].status = fstat_missing;
			is_changed = TRUE;
		}
	}

	if (is_changed) {
		inv_save(*invp);
	}

out:
	NOTNULL_FREE(ent);
	if (dirp != NULL) {
		closedir(dirp);
	}

	return (rst);
}

static int
do_test (void)
{
  int ret = 0;
  static const char *fifo_name = "some-fifo";

  size_t filenamelen = strlen (dirbuf) + strlen (fifo_name) + 2;
  char *filename = xmalloc (filenamelen);

  snprintf (filename, filenamelen, "%s/%s", dirbuf, fifo_name);

  /* Create a fifo in the directory.  */
  int e = mkfifo (filename, 0777);
  if (e == -1)
    {
      printf ("fifo creation failed (%s)\n", strerror (errno));
      ret = 1;
      goto out_nofifo;
    }

  long dir_pathconf = pathconf (dirbuf, _PC_PIPE_BUF);

  if (dir_pathconf < 0)
    {
      printf ("pathconf on directory failed: %s\n", strerror (errno));
      ret = 1;
      goto out_nofifo;
    }

  long fifo_pathconf = pathconf (filename, _PC_PIPE_BUF);

  if (fifo_pathconf < 0)
    {
      printf ("pathconf on file failed: %s\n", strerror (errno));
      ret = 1;
      goto out_nofifo;
    }

  int fifo = open (filename, O_RDONLY | O_NONBLOCK);

  if (fifo < 0)
    {
      printf ("fifo open failed (%s)\n", strerror (errno));
      ret = 1;
      goto out_nofifo;
    }

  long dir_fpathconf = fpathconf (dir_fd, _PC_PIPE_BUF);

  if (dir_fpathconf < 0)
    {
      printf ("fpathconf on directory failed: %s\n", strerror (errno));
      ret = 1;
      goto out;
    }

  long fifo_fpathconf = fpathconf (fifo, _PC_PIPE_BUF);

  if (fifo_fpathconf < 0)
    {
      printf ("fpathconf on file failed: %s\n", strerror (errno));
      ret = 1;
      goto out;
    }

  if (fifo_pathconf != fifo_fpathconf)
    {
      printf ("fifo pathconf (%ld) != fifo fpathconf (%ld)\n", fifo_pathconf,
	      fifo_fpathconf);
      ret = 1;
      goto out;
    }

  if (dir_pathconf != fifo_pathconf)
    {
      printf ("directory pathconf (%ld) != fifo pathconf (%ld)\n",
	      dir_pathconf, fifo_pathconf);
      ret = 1;
      goto out;
    }

  if (dir_fpathconf != fifo_fpathconf)
    {
      printf ("directory fpathconf (%ld) != fifo fpathconf (%ld)\n",
	      dir_fpathconf, fifo_fpathconf);
      ret = 1;
      goto out;
    }

out:
  close (fifo);
out_nofifo:
  close (dir_fd);

  if (unlink (filename) != 0)
    {
      printf ("Could not remove fifo (%s)\n", strerror (errno));
      ret = 1;
    }

  return ret;
}

static int
cacl_get(acl_inp inp, int get_flag, int type, acl_t **aclp)
{
	const char *fname;
	int fd;
	int ace_acl = 0;
	int error;
	int getcmd, cntcmd;
	acl_t *acl_info;
	int	save_errno;
	int	stat_error;
	struct stat64 statbuf;

	*aclp = NULL;
	if (type == ACL_PATH) {
		fname = inp.file;
		ace_acl = pathconf(fname, _PC_ACL_ENABLED);
	} else {
		fd = inp.fd;
		ace_acl = fpathconf(fd, _PC_ACL_ENABLED);
	}

	/*
	 * if acl's aren't supported then
	 * send it through the old GETACL interface
	 */
	if (ace_acl == 0 || ace_acl == -1) {
		ace_acl = _ACL_ACLENT_ENABLED;
	}

	if (ace_acl & _ACL_ACE_ENABLED) {
		cntcmd = ACE_GETACLCNT;
		getcmd = ACE_GETACL;
		acl_info = acl_alloc(ACE_T);
	} else {
		cntcmd = GETACLCNT;
		getcmd = GETACL;
		acl_info = acl_alloc(ACLENT_T);
	}

	if (acl_info == NULL)
		return (-1);

	if (type == ACL_PATH) {
		acl_info->acl_cnt = acl(fname, cntcmd, 0, NULL);
	} else {
		acl_info->acl_cnt = facl(fd, cntcmd, 0, NULL);
	}

	save_errno = errno;
	if (acl_info->acl_cnt < 0) {
		acl_free(acl_info);
		errno = save_errno;
		return (-1);
	}

	if (acl_info->acl_cnt == 0) {
		acl_free(acl_info);
		errno = save_errno;
		return (0);
	}

	acl_info->acl_aclp =
	    malloc(acl_info->acl_cnt * acl_info->acl_entry_size);
	save_errno = errno;

	if (acl_info->acl_aclp == NULL) {
		acl_free(acl_info);
		errno = save_errno;
		return (-1);
	}

	if (type == ACL_PATH) {
		stat_error = stat64(fname, &statbuf);
		error = acl(fname, getcmd, acl_info->acl_cnt,
		    acl_info->acl_aclp);
	} else {
		stat_error = fstat64(fd, &statbuf);
		error = facl(fd, getcmd, acl_info->acl_cnt,
		    acl_info->acl_aclp);
	}

	save_errno = errno;
	if (error == -1) {
		acl_free(acl_info);
		errno = save_errno;
		return (-1);
	}


	if (stat_error == 0) {
		acl_info->acl_flags =
		    (S_ISDIR(statbuf.st_mode) ? ACL_IS_DIR : 0);
	} else
		acl_info->acl_flags = 0;

	switch (acl_info->acl_type) {
	case ACLENT_T:
		if (acl_info->acl_cnt <= MIN_ACL_ENTRIES)
			acl_info->acl_flags |= ACL_IS_TRIVIAL;
		break;
	case ACE_T:
		if (ace_trivial(acl_info->acl_aclp, acl_info->acl_cnt) == 0)
			acl_info->acl_flags |= ACL_IS_TRIVIAL;
		break;
	default:
		errno = EINVAL;
		acl_free(acl_info);
		return (-1);
	}

	if ((acl_info->acl_flags & ACL_IS_TRIVIAL) &&
	    (get_flag & ACL_NO_TRIVIAL)) {
		acl_free(acl_info);
		errno = 0;
		return (0);
	}

	*aclp = acl_info;
	return (0);
}
